A Systematic Overview of the Floral Diversity in Myrteae (Myrtaceae).
With ca. 2500 species, Myrteae is the largest tribe of Myrtaceae and one of the most diverse groups of flowering plants in the tropical Americas. In light of recent systematics adjustments, the present study is a review and provides new insights into floral diversity and evolution in Myrteae. General aspects...Vasconcelos, Thais N.
